BREAKING: Indiana Secretary of State takes action against local mortgage lender

TERRE HAUTE — The Indiana Secretary of State’s office filed an official complaint today alleging fraudulent practices at a Terre Haute-based mortgage lending company, Affordable Lending on Wabash Avenue.

The 51-page complaint also names two property buyers, Rick N. Burnett and Kris Sommerville, as well as Sullivan-based title company, Hoosier Title.

The Secretary of State’s office alleges Burnett and Sommerville falsified information on 23 mortgage loan applications for properties totaling $1.4 million.

The complaint alleges several loan originators and closing agents working for Affordable Lending and Hoosier Title assisted the buyers in obtaining loans using the false or incomplete information.

“Falsifying information to obtain a loan is fraud,” said Indiana Secretary of State Todd Rokita in a press statement issued today. “Our foreclosure rate in Indiana is one of the highest in the nation, but we can work to reverse that trend by educating home buyers and by protecting the industry from damaging, fraudulent behavior,” Rokita said.
